Sub-Division of East Battersea. Population (estimated to middle of 1908)—76,321.
Deaths in the year of Legitimate Infants, 190; Illegitimate Infants, 27 .
Births in the year—Legitimate, 2,030; Illegitimate, 57.
Deaths from all Causes at all ages—993.
